Transaction 158d3f72450520fb616a8dcb1c103b4cda798652d9b8a9abf6fccbab4ed885a6

1 Input
2 Outputs
  • 158d3f72450520fb616a8dcb1c103b4cda798652d9b8a9abf6fccbab4ed885a6:0
  • value  18250918124
    address  2N75K1JEXzGg5TZZLaUhZ2ZUfp8FmVhTZ5L
  • 158d3f72450520fb616a8dcb1c103b4cda798652d9b8a9abf6fccbab4ed885a6:1
  • value  11189078
    address  2NBMEX3C7kBMPMgzncU433M3ao8iaMDKpJX